The game features exploration, crafting, building, painting, and combat with a variety of creatures in a procedurally generated 2D world. Terraria received … The Marble Biome is an underground biome. It's made out of Marble Blocks and Marble Walls. Just like it's counterpart, the Granite Biome, a world may contain multiple Marble Biomes. A nearby Marble Biome can contain underground houses made out of Marble Furniture, Chests and Walls. However the chests contain the same loot as a regular Gold Chest found underground. All you need is a couple marble or granite blocks underground, in their raw form, of course smooth blocks work too, apparently - and then the biome specific mobs will start spawning alongside cavern mobs. The actual number needed to start spawning is very low. In my experience twelve was all that was needed (a single block was not enough). The Marble Cave is a mini-biome found in the Cavern layer. It is made entirely out of Marble Blocks and Marble Walls, and contains several Pots of a design unique to the area. It normally generates as a long, singular horizontal passage, but the shape can be affected by overlapping cave systems.

However, building a farm in this way will result in normal underground enemies (and possibly jungle bats/slimes, if you activated the jungle) competing for …The Hoplite is an enemy that spawns in Marble Caves. It throws piercing Javelins at the player, which can deal a lot of damage, especially if in Expert Mode or higher difficulties. The Javelins thrown are also fairly accurate, and are more likely to hit the player than most other enemy-fired projectiles.
